27/07/2024
this is how you can create a fourth dimension with ai.....
si i logged back in
ChatGPT
Welcome back! How can I assist you today?
you remember our last conversation, who are you
ChatGPT
Yes, I remember. I'm Quanta. How can I assist you today?
trust is hard to find as a human
ChatGPT
I understand. Trust is indeed a precious and sometimes difficult thing to establish. If there's anything specific you'd like to discuss or any way I can help, feel free to let me know.
i wish in the evoulution of man that we can develope technology to a point where you can feel such things like emotion or wind on the hair of a droid refrencing data in star treck even though that might be far away do you think that might make you happy ? short response
ChatGPT
That would be an incredible advancement! Experiencing emotions and sensations could indeed bring a new dimension to existence. It’s a fascinating idea to consider.
thank you for the hints
ChatGPT
You're welcome! If you have any more thoughts or questions, feel free to share.
how can we spit a byte like hexidecimal
ChatGPT
To split a byte into hexadecimal representation, you can convert it to a two-character string where each character represents 4 bits (a nibble). Here's how you can do it in Python:
python
Copy code
def split_byte_to_hex(byte):
# Ensure the input is within the range of a byte (0-255)
if 0 4) & 0x0F
Low nibble: low_nibble = b & 0x0F
Convert each nibble:
Use a lookup table for hexadecimal characters: hex_digits = "0123456789abcdef"
high_hex = hex_digits[high_nibble]
low_hex = hex_digits[low_nibble]
For example, for the byte value 255 (which is 0xFF in hexadecimal):
high_nibble = (255 >> 4) & 0x0F results in 15 (which is 0xF).
low_nibble = 255 & 0x0F results in 15 (which is also 0xF).
Using the lookup table:
high_hex = hex_digits[15] results in "f".
low_hex = hex_digits[15] results in "f".
So, the byte 255 splits into high_hex = "f" and low_hex = "f".
now spit that byte in the fourth dimesion
ChatGPT
Splitting a byte in the fourth dimension adds a conceptual layer to the process. In the context of data and computing, dimensions can be thought of in different ways, such as addressing, indexing, or even representing data in higher-dimensional space.
However, considering the abstract nature of "splitting a byte in the fourth dimension," let's interpret it through a mathematical or theoretical lens:
Mathematical Interpretation: In mathematics, higher dimensions often involve extra components or coordinates. If we extend the idea of splitting a byte (8 bits) into four parts, each part could be represented in a four-dimensional space.
Theoretical Interpretation: In theoretical computing, a fourth dimension might represent another axis of data organization or processing.
Here's an attempt to split a byte into four 2-bit segments and represent each segment as a coordinate in a four-dimensional space:
Divide the byte:
Segment the byte into four 2-bit parts.
Convert each part:
Convert each 2-bit part to its decimal equivalent.
Represent in 4D space:
Each part can be seen as a coordinate in a 4D vector.
Here’s how you can do it:
Divide the byte:
For a byte b:
Part 1: (b >> 6) & 0x03
Part 2: (b >> 4) & 0x03
Part 3: (b >> 2) & 0x03
Part 4: b & 0x03
Convert each part:
Each part is already a 2-bit number, so its value is between 0 and 3.
Represent in 4D space:
The four parts become the coordinates of a 4D vector.
For example, for the byte value 255 (which is 11111111 in binary):
Divide the byte:
Part 1: (255 >> 6) & 0x03 results in 3 (binary 11).
Part 2: (255 >> 4) & 0x03 results in 3 (binary 11).
Part 3: (255 >> 2) & 0x03 results in 3 (binary 11).
Part 4: 255 & 0x03 results in 3 (binary 11).
Convert each part:
Each part is 3.
Represent in 4D space:
The byte 255 is represented as the 4D vector (3, 3, 3, 3).
This conceptual approach extends the idea of splitting a byte into higher dimensions by treating each segment as a coordinate in a multi-dimensional space.
how many bytes did you make from nothing?
ChatGPT
In the context of the example given, we did not create any new bytes from nothing. Instead, we simply divided an existing byte into smaller parts. Specifically, we took one byte (8 bits) and split it into four 2-bit segments.
Here's a quick summary:
Original Byte: One byte (e.g., 255 or 11111111 in binary).
Divided Byte: Four 2-bit segments, which are parts of the original byte.
So, from the original one byte, we derived four smaller segments, but we didn't create additional bytes from nothing. The total amount of information remains the same, just represented differently.
so you know i see where you are putting data
ChatGPT
Yes, I understand. When we split the byte into smaller segments, we're simply reorganizing the existing data rather than creating new data. Each segment retains a part of the original byte's information. If you have any further questions or need a different explanation, feel free to ask!
keep it as yours
ChatGPT
Memory updated
Got it! If there's anything specific you'd like to dive into next, just let me know.